UK seeing second COVID-19 wave, says PM Boris Johnson



LONDON: The UK is “now seeing a second wave” of COVID-19, Prime Minister Boris Johnson has said, adding: “It’s been inevitable we’d see it in this country.”

Johnson said he did not “want to go into bigger lockdown measures” but that tighter social distancing rules might be necessary, BBC reported.

It is understood a new three-tiered set of restrictions is being considered.

The plan would aim to avoid a national lockdown but could stop household-to-household contact.
